The British Academy, in collaboration with the UK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office (FCDO), invites early and mid-career professionals to apply for the prestigious Innovation Fellowships 2025–26, under Route B: Policy-Led.
This 12-month fellowship allows scholars in humanities and social sciences to engage with real-world policy challenges, making their research relevant beyond academia. With strategic partnerships and targeted policy domains, applicants will co-create solutions that influence decision-making at national and global levels.
🎯 What Is the Policy-Led Innovation Fellowship?
The Route B: Policy-Led track under the Innovation Fellowships Scheme connects dynamic researchers with institutions like the FCDO to work on contemporary, urgent, and impactful themes — such as humanitarian crises, national security, and organized migration crimes.
Participants will work hand-in-hand with UK policymakers to provide evidence-based solutions to serious global and local policy challenges. Through this, fellows will bridge the gap between academic insights and real-world decision-making.
🌍 Key Features of the Fellowship
- Fellowship Duration: 12 months (Full-time)
- Funding Support: Up to £120,000 (at 80% Full Economic Costing)
- Start Date: Between January 1 and March 31, 2026
- Application Deadline: October 1, 2025 (17:00 BST)
- Eligible Disciplines: Humanities and Social Sciences
- Eligibility: Open to all nationalities (Male/Female researchers)
- Level Required: Early-career or Mid-career (no degree necessary for application eligibility)

✔️ 1. Real Policy Impact
Your research can directly shape government policies in areas like:
- Regional stabilization in the Western Balkans
- Strategies to combat Serious Organized Crime and Migration Patterns
- Humanitarian response improvement and risk mitigation
- Evolving the UK National Security Strategy

📝 Who Can Apply?
To be eligible, you must:
- Be an early- to mid-career researcher nationally or internationally
- Work within the scope of Humanities or Social Sciences
- Be ready to partner with FCDO and other policy-driven institutions
- Finish required security clearance and agree to a January–March 2026 start window
No age limit or nationality barrier exists, making this a truly inclusive opportunity.
